Transaction 71efa0e798d17ba8235223a81a0ff11b998dd84390bd2c061d8894eafbc12f88

3 Input
2 Outputs
  • 71efa0e798d17ba8235223a81a0ff11b998dd84390bd2c061d8894eafbc12f88:0
  • value  2075989520
    address  1HNY1rsg7eB4nRC3LNhiT3e4kjNcgiWGTa
  • 71efa0e798d17ba8235223a81a0ff11b998dd84390bd2c061d8894eafbc12f88:1
  • value  11861486
    address  323LE6bHZFRrBCAYBctwJ1UWwEf6Q27BYo